In Mousim Mitra‘s water color paintings called “Nature Tales” the beauty of nature unfolds in its various moods. Often meditative or mysterious, a sense of motion is present in its stillness. Through Nature Tales Mousim explored the truth in these forms and the oneness with it felt through his experiences.
Eminent painter Ms. Shobha Broota said, “The overall paintings are very appealing. Most of them have the power of taking you in another realm within. The simplicity and color quality both are extremely powerful. The freshness in application reveals spontaneity and surety of vision. Although somewhere the additional uses of realistic elements like figures and somewhere boats (not everywhere) are taking away the strength and depth of Mousim’s works, which is otherwise very strong and powerful.”
‘Nature Tales’ delves in portraying the contrast in nature- brightness and darkness, stillness and motion, solid form of huge rocks and tranquility of water, solitude in boats and restlessness of a sea or river, energetic red and cold black.
Mousim Mitra, a communication design graduate from prestigious National Institute of Design Ahmedabad is currently working with Grey Worldwide Kolkata as Creative Director. Under his leadership the company had won one of the largest national account. He has also received an award in ‘PROTIDIN SRIJON SAMMAN’ and his Venture Brochures got published in “Brochure Design that Works”, Rockport Publication, Philadelphia.
